碰到个棘手的事情windows下 有个  200多G的文件 ,要给了linux,  网络估计是甲方做过调整,   当文件传到 50多G的时候,网络就被杀了,然后直接从0%开始,不能续传。(工具flashfxp) 就想了个办法   用压缩软件  10G一个包  a.z01 a.z02  a.zip 分隔了。。但是传到 hpux 下  合并不了。unzip不行。。
后来尝试了 用 7zip ,只要分割了就没戏。求高人指点 谢谢~

解决方案 »

  1.   

    接受完毕,可以在合并之后检查下HASH值对不对,如果不同,可以参考下面的链接内容:https://m.jb51.net/LINUXjishu/235918.html,
    如果相同也不行,那简直了
      

  2.   

    显然是 windows 分隔了以后, 在linux上 解压缩  ,不认识分隔后的 兄弟姐妹文件。
      

  3.   

    那要不试试手动cat?
      

  4.   

    在windows下通过winrar将文件分割,然后去Linux下通过unrar x 将文件解压。unrar是winrar的linux版rarlinux中的命令  ,不过就是不知道hpux能不能装上rarlinux
      

  5.   

    7zip是可以的, 如果说分成了3份, FILE.zip.001 FILE.zip.002 FILE.zip.003, 都放入到了Linux中,
    在linux 中 使用下面命令组合解压即可(rar分隔的zip是不可以的)[root]# cat FILE.zip.001 FILE.zip.002 FILE.zip.003 > FILE.zip
    [root]# unzip FILE.zip注意: cat 文件顺序是不能颠倒的
      

  6.   

     我百度到了,,,试了下,还是不认, 不知道是不是hp-ux 和 rhel的 差别。
      

  7.   

    我这这个项目 正好是个hp-ux,以前接触这个系统少。
      

  8.   

    直接用cat命令,比如cat 01 02 > all就可以了